Javafx 2 如何将3ds模型导入JAVAFX?

Javafx 2 如何将3ds模型导入JAVAFX?,javafx-2,3ds,Javafx 2,3ds,下面是加载程序,但我找不到如何在internet上使用代码的示例。我有很多模型,因为我是一名3d建模师,但我不知道如何使用以下链接将我的3ds模型导入javafx。任何帮助都将不胜感激。谢谢 使用来加载您的模型 这将允许您检查3D模型导入器和JavaFX 3D是否能够加载和渲染3ds模型。这是一个值得检查的问题,因为3D模型导入器和JavaFX3D API目前都是早期access版本,在显示特定模型时可能存在一些问题或限制 如果模型浏览器应用程序适用于您的模型,并且您希望将3ds模型导入到您自己

下面是加载程序,但我找不到如何在internet上使用代码的示例。我有很多模型,因为我是一名3d建模师,但我不知道如何使用以下链接将我的3ds模型导入javafx。任何帮助都将不胜感激。谢谢

使用来加载您的模型

这将允许您检查3D模型导入器和JavaFX 3D是否能够加载和渲染3ds模型。这是一个值得检查的问题,因为3D模型导入器和JavaFX3D API目前都是早期access版本,在显示特定模型时可能存在一些问题或限制

如果模型浏览器应用程序适用于您的模型,并且您希望将3ds模型导入到您自己的程序中,您可以调整答案的变体:由于该答案处理STL文件,若要导入3ds文件,请用
TdsModelImporter
替换STL导入器。测试线束代码的其余部分保持不变(对照明、模型比例等进行适当调整)

包括有关3ds模型使用
TdsModelImporter
的api javadoc

如有进一步问题,我建议您直接联系


使用InteractiveMesh 3D模型浏览器加载3Ds模型

ModelImporter tdsImporter = new TdsModelImporter();
tdsImporter.read(fileUrl);
Node[] tdsMesh = (Node[]) tdsImporter.getImport();
tdsImporter.close();